Court dismisses former city liquor commissioner's case against city, state officials

Former Baltimore liquor board commissioner Douglas Trotter filed a lawsuit against the Gov. Larry Hogan, Mayor Stephanie Rawlings-Blake and other entities over a law that transfered the power of liquor board appointments to the city. The court dismissed the case. (Amy Davis / Baltimore Sun)
